In this session, you will learn about: 
- Identify living beings and living land in everyday scenes 
- Use the environment to support your subject, not distract from it 
- Capture moments of connection that bring photos to life 
- Compose scenes that feel dynamic and alive, not flat 
- Apply simple techniques (light, movement, positioning) to improve storytelling
